California·Code FAM Family Code - FAM·Div. 20. DIVISION 20. PILOT PROJECTS·Part 1. PART 1. FAMILY LAW PILOT PROJECTS·Ch. 3. CHAPTER 3. Santa Clara County Pilot Project
(a)It is estimated for Santa Clara County’s participation in the pilot project authorized by this chapter, that 4,000 litigants will be served annually, and that the following savings will occur:
(1)With an estimated 20 percent reduction in the use of court time over the current system, the county would save approximately 178 hours per year of court time, or approximately 22 workdays per year.
(2)With an estimated cost savings in incomes of judges, court reporters, clerks, bailiffs, and sheriffs, the project is expected to save approximately twenty thousand dollars ($20,000) per year. Cases involving child support obligations which the district attorney’s office was required to handle in one participating county, for the 1989–90 fiscal year, number 2,461.
